Description


The Aluminium Alloy Robot Car Chassis is a durable and lightweight platform designed for building reliable robotic vehicles. Made from high-quality aluminium alloy, it offers excellent strength while maintaining low weight, making it ideal for both educational and hobbyist robotics projects.

The chassis features multiple mounting holes and slots, allowing easy installation of motors, wheels, sensors, and control boards. Its modular design makes it highly adaptable for various robotic and automation applications.



Key Features

  • Strong Aluminium Construction – High durability with excellent mechanical strength
  • Lightweight Design – Improves mobility and efficiency of robotic vehicles
  • Flexible Mounting Options – Multiple holes for motors, sensors, and electronics
  • Wide Motor Compatibility – Supports DC, servo, and stepper motors
  • Expandable Platform – Easy to customize and upgrade with additional modules
  • Easy Assembly – Pre-drilled holes for quick and simple setup


Specification

  • Material: Aluminium Alloy
  • Dimensions: 25cm × 15cm × 5cm
  • Thickness: 2mm
  • Weight: 200g
  • Color: Silver (Natural Aluminium Finish)
  • Motor Mount Compatibility: Standard DC motors and servo motors
  • Wheel Compatibility: Standard robot car wheels
  • Included Accessories: Screws, nuts, and mounting hardware
